Indeed, the Prophet’s kindness and compassion continue to inspire hearts across generations. Bilal ibn Rabah (RA), the sweet caller to Islam, exemplifies unwavering devotion and resilience. Born into slavery, he endured unimaginable torture for embracing the message of tawheed-the Oneness of Allah. His unwavering faith and unbreakable bond with the Prophet (PBUH) serve as a beacon for us all. And then there’s Julaibib (RA), whose name means “small gown.” Despite his physical appearance, he was a giant in character. The Prophet (PBUH) recognised his worth and said, “This man is of me, and I am of him.” Julaibib’s story teaches us that true greatness lies not in outward appearance but in the purity of the heart. Both Bilal and Julaibib remind us that Islam transcends social status, race, and appearance. It’s about sincerity, compassion, and standing up for justice. They were both outcasts in society, yet they found acceptance and honour in the eyes of Allah and His Messenger. May we all strive to embody their spirit-to be kind, compassionate, and inclusive.
